Transaction 74bb9f650012fc5f47af2eb43ab4613705ab91be401e97db5852123a378ec7ca
1 Input
2 Outputs
- 74bb9f650012fc5f47af2eb43ab4613705ab91be401e97db5852123a378ec7ca:0
- 74bb9f650012fc5f47af2eb43ab4613705ab91be401e97db5852123a378ec7ca:1
value 38507
address 3GbErSSA1YtSjG2dMwdGbVqbGCmMZa6Yk6
value 1374796
address 1K4kUDRhWGiHn9H7YgFMsUJgfyDsvGpYNf